خلاصه مقاله:
Introduction: Fatigue and abnormalities in cardiovascular parameters are recognized as major problems for patients with acute coronary syndrome. Non-pharmacological nursing interventions are useful for controlling this fatigue and reducing patients’ suffering during hospitalization. Aim: The present study compared the effects of aromatherapy massage and reflexology on fatigue and cardiovascular parameters in female older patients with acute coronary syndrome. Design: This randomized clinical trial.Materials and Methods: The study was conducted with ۱۳۵ female older patients with acute coronary syndrome who were hospitalized on a cardiac care unit in ۲۰۱۴. The patients with ACS, hospitalized in the CCU, were invited to take part in the study. Then were randomly divided into three groups: aromatherapy massage, reflexology, and control. The fatigue severity and cardiovascular parameters were assessed through the Rhoten fatigue scale and a checklist, respectively. Measurements in the groups were performed before and immediately after the intervention. Data analysis was performed using descriptive and analytical statistics via the SPSS software.Results: Aromatherapy massage significantly decreased fatigue, systolic blood pressure, mean arterial pressure and O۲ saturation greater than reflexology. However, reflexology reduced heart rate more than aromatherapy massage (P < ۰.۰۵). Moreover, no significant changes were observed in diastolic blood pressures compared to the control group (P = ۰.۳۷).Conclusions: Implementation of both aromatherapy massage and reflexology has positive effects on fatigue and cardiovascular parameters in patients with acute coronary syndrome. However, aromatherapy massage can be more beneficial to apply as a supportive approach in coronary diseases. Relevance to clinical practice: The need for reducing fatigue in ACS patients on a cardiac are unit is evident. Implementation of aromatherapy massage and reflexology has positive effects on fatigue in these patients physical and mental health.
